Responsibilities:


  • Answer phone calls
  • Patient intake
  • Authorization tracking since we are a out of network facility
  • Billing (collecting payments, entering charges, etc.)
  • Assisting therapist with scanning/filing
  • Assist with keeping office tidy and clean
  • Utilization of Net Health EMR
  • Works together with Office Manager to cover time off (PTO/PST)
  • Maintains strong customer service at all times
  • Identifies, prioritizes and responds to families' needs in a timely, professional and effective manner
  • Explains policies, procedures and billing practices to families
  • Perform other duties as requested

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ent required
  • Basic knowledge of computers skills including but not limited to keyboard familiarity and word processing, office procedures, filing, verbal and written communication skills, fax, photocopy required
  • Customer service and interpersonal skills necessary to communicate effectively with staff members, supportive personnel, patients, physicians and community members required
  • Three years in medical office setting that required multitasking preferred
  • Knowledge of health insurance preferred
